Show Spoiler Sleeping Soldier Walkers Spoiler

3 Upvotes

Saw a post about the sleeping soldier Walkers the group encounters and how the poster thought it was stupid that they didn’t simply silently kill them all instead of doing their little sneak mission.

Figured I’d give my two cents on why I think the survivors actually did the smart thing by doing it silently without trying to kill any Walkers.

I assume they didn’t due to the chance that one or several dozen of them could’ve had explosives on them. Remember the one Aiden Monroe shot? The one with grenades? He got blown across the room and impaled, then devoured. Or the mine field when there group met Princess, which set off a chain reaction I believe Eugene called a cascade? Wouldn’t have ended pretty for them.

If one grenade goes, it could create a chain of explosions and shrapnel going off all over the place, killing everyone nearby and destroying all the supplies. And that’s not even mentioning the possibility of other explosives in the area not on the Walkers.

Yes, they could’ve tried silently eliminating them, but that wouldn’t end well either, since the smell of blood and the sound of blades going through skulls would most likely wake up at least one Walker, which would naturally wake up every single one. And that’s did happen with a simple drop of blood. Living blood, yes, but it’s still too dangerous.

Even if they tried to simply wake them up and guide them away, they also run the possibility of one of the Walkers bumping into another and accidentally pulling a pin, once again setting off the chain reaction of explosions.

And to top it all off, that would bring every Walker for miles to the now injured survivors, assuming any of them survived in the first place.

Yes, there was a chance the Walkers may not have had any grenades or explosives of any kind on them, but that’s one hell of a risk they’d be taking. Just one or two would be extremely dangerous. If they all grenades, then they would’ve been completely and utterly fucked.
